WebOct 9, 2010 · If your cutting a curve around a pipe or the wc pedestal then if you place the tile against a hot radiator for 30 seconds it will become very pliable and easy to cut. One last warning, with some of the very tough, polished Amtico tiles, the knife blade can skate across the surface and damage the tile, or worse, cut your fingers, so take it easy. S WebYes you can lay an LVT product over ceramics as long as they are solid to the subfloor, remove any ceramics that are broken or loose. You will have to latex screed over minimum of 3mm, for the finished floor to look good this latex screed needs to be as smooth as glass. Answered 5th Apr 2024. Like 0. homes in southern pines
